发明名称 MAGNETIC FIELD DETECTING SENSOR
摘要 PROBLEM TO BE SOLVED: To provide an inexpensive high-sensitivity magnetic field detecting sensor which can reduce the fluctuation of detected values due to the spatial magnetic field distribution of an object to be detected. SOLUTION: A magnetic field detecting sensor 1 is provided with a magnetic field detecting section 2 having upper and lower magnetic layers 2b and 2a formed on a substrate and a conductive layer 4 formed between the magnetic layers 2b and 2a and connected to a high-frequency power source and a magnetic field converging section 3 the width of which becomes broader as going toward an object to be detected, such as the shaft, etc., and which is connected directly to the detecting section 2 and transmits magnetic fluxes directly or indirectly leaking out from the object to be detected by converging the magnetic fluxes. The sensor detects the variation of the magnetic field in the object to be detected as the variation of the magnetic permeability of the detecting section 2. Since the magnetic field converging section 3 converges and averages the magnetic fluxes leaking out from the object, the sensor can detect a true magnetic field variation with accuracy.
